Will Thompson Raise Enough Money?

Cal Thomas

Syndicated Columnist

September 5, 2007

Former Tennessee senator Fred Thompson will announce on Jay Leno’s show tonight he is a candidate for the Republican nomination for President.

I know Thompson a little and I like him. His commentaries when he sits in for Paul Harvey are excellent. But I wonder if he’s waited too long. Already he’s had several staff shakeups, which is not a good sign in a campaign. I also wonder if the initial enthusiasm for him came more from the lack of enthusiasm for the other GOP candidates or was it genuine?

Thompson has good conservative positions on a number of issues, from fighting terrorism, to closing the borders to keep out illegal aliens, to lower taxes and smaller government. But he has not yet articulated a vision, or said why he wants to be President. Both are essential. Perhaps he will in the days ahead.

Four months before the first primary sounds like a long time, but a lot of money must be raised to run for President and the question is whether Thompson can raise it quickly? We will soon know.
